* In the England and Wales Longitudinal Study (ONS LS) and the Northern Ireland Longitudinal Study (NILS) synthetic data are currently being implemented
Synthetic data are given only to approved researchers who are granted access to the original sensitive data after signing a disclaimer.
Researchers are provided with a single synthetic version of a project-specific extract.
Data are labelled appropriately to make it clear that they are synthetic.
Synthetic data are used for preliminary analysis and the development of data cleaning and analysis code.
Final analyses have to be run on the original data.
Substantial costs and time savings related to visits to safe havens by researchers can be made.
